Bottle@Home. Sweet malty and grainy aroma. Brown colour, beige head, good lace. Pretty sweet, light bitter, malty, hints of caramel and dried dark fruit. Tasted like the lesser version of Lindeboom Echt 2009.

Bottle 30cl. @ RBESG 09 Grand Tasting @ [ The Harlequin, Sheffield, England. ]
Clear medium amber color with a average, frothy, good lacing, mostly lasting, off-white to beige head. Aroma is moderate malty, caramel, syrup - molasses. Flavor is moderate sweet and light bitter with a average duration. Body is medium, texture is oily, carbonation is soft. [20090719]
